The Bachelor of Arts in Physics at the University of Texas at Arlington is a comprehensive program that stands out as one of the most sought-after degree offerings in the field of physics. This program not only provides a robust foundation in core physics principles but also emphasizes interdisciplinary approaches, preparing students to innovate and excel in various scientific fields. With a curriculum carefully structured to include both theoretical knowledge and practical applications, students will engage in a learning journey that enhances their problem-solving skills and critical thinking abilities, essential for today’s dynamic scientific environment.

Throughout the course, students will have access to advanced laboratory facilities and state-of-the-art equipment, which allows for hands-on experimentation and research. The curriculum features a diverse array of courses, ranging from classical mechanics to quantum physics, and includes specialized topics such as thermodynamics, electromagnetism, and modern physics. Furthermore, students can delve into elective courses that explore related fields like astrophysics, biophysics, and computational physics, giving them the flexibility to tailor their education according to their interests and career aspirations.
